Engineers form the backbone of any country’s economy. around 25% of the world’s engineers are in india but it lags behind in research and innovation. at the global level, engineering education is experiencing a paradigm shift from teacher centric to student centric teaching learning process, content based education to outcome based. A recent employability report has found that over 80 percent of engineers in india are unemployable as they lack the technological skills required by employers now. new delhi, updated: mar 21, 2019 10:31 ist. every year, thousands of engineering graduates pass out of college, but only a tiny handful of them are trained in the skills that. 4. the report provides the primary reasons for low employability of india’s engineers — only 40 percent engineering graduates do an internship, while a mere 7 percent students do multiple.
